Be holy, for I Am Holy
Leviticus is a difficult read. It, however is a book of holiness; what God expects of His people. The Christian today is not saved by holiness, but by grace through faith in the One who is holy, and presented Himself as the sacrifice for our sin; our unholiness. Through Him we are holy.
